Are people in Morgantown older or younger than people in Canton?
- The Median Age in Morgantown is 12.4 years older than in Canton.
Are housing costs cheaper in Morgantown or Canton?
- Morgantown
housing
costs are 51.8% more expensive than Canton hous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Morgantown or Canton?
- The average commute for residents of Morgantown is 5.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Canton.
